Board Seeks Comment on Reg K Amendments
In a recent press release , the Board requested comment on proposed amendments (PDF) to Reg K requiring Edge and Agreement corporations and U.S. branches, agencies, and other offices of foreign banks supervised by the Board to establish procedures for ensuring compliance with the Bank Secrecy Act. Comments must be submitted by June 30.
Fed Beige Book Released
The Board's latest Beige Book dated June 11, 2003 has all Districts reporting that while there are some signs of increased economic activity, conditions remain sluggish in most Districts. Details are available in the full report, including individual Reserve Bank summaries.
